In computer networking, a workgroup is a collection of computers on a local area network (LAN) that share common resources and responsibilities. The term is most commonly associated with Microsoft Windows workgroups but also applies to other environments. Windows workgroups can be found in homes, schools, and small businesses.Educational strategies and tactics can define roles for participants, both for presential and online activities. Implementing Group Work in the Classroom. Group work can be an effective method to motivate students, encourage active learning, and develop key critical-thinking, communication, and decision-making skills. When possible, choose group members with similar schedules. Online students reside in different time zones and can have opposing work schedules. 2. Be proactive and begin setting the groundwork early. As online learners, your time is extremely precious. 3. Align group roles and responsibilities with individual strengths and interests. 4.

Clearly define and assign the group roles and responsibilities so that each person will contribute equally. Increase individual accountability by combining group assessments with individual assessments. Provide a mechanism for teams to dismiss a member.
